Eagle Clamp EK Type Vertical Clamp For Steel Plate

Products Made in Japan
Manufacturer: Eagle Clamp
Model: EK Type
Features
- Latch type locking device that works reliably (spring type tightening mechanism)
- Automatic tightening mechanism with strong force due to loading.
- Tighten with a force more than twice the fishing load / Grip force proportional to fishing load / No unnecessary scratches on the load
- Special alloy steel made by induction quenching
- Crack resistant high tensile strength steel body
- Circular swinging jaw grasping loads ·
- Large hanging ring for easy handling
- Baking finish (epoxy paint) finishing
- Wide mouth type suitable for lifting light and thick members

Use
Transportations, lifting, inverting, assembling, mounting, pressing, bending processing, welding.
Applicable elements
Steel plate, flat steel, section steel, forging, casting, crane girder, crane beam, iron arrow board, iron steel structure, steel beam, steel frame.
